新建文件夹spring-cloud-alibaba IDEA打开文件夹,文件夹下创建pom.xml,注意加入maven项目管理 一定要主要版本搭配,不然会报错。具体参考此链接,也有配置,依赖相关的文档: https://github.com/alibaba/spring-cloud-alibaba#version-control-guidelines <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http:...
>springCloudAlibaba</artifactId> <version>0.0.1-SNAPSHOT</version> <name>springCloudAlibaba</name> <description>springCloudAlibaba</description> <packaging>pom</packaging> <properties> <java.version>1.8</java.version> <spring-cloud.version>2021.0.3</spring-cloud.version> <spring-cloud.alibaba....
SpringCloud Alibaba的进阶:代码的优化和改善,微服务监控 课程进阶会讲那些内容? 课程思路: 分析并拆解微服务 编写代码 分析现有架构问题 引入微服务组件 优化重构 SpringCloud Alibaba的重要组件精讲,如图所示: 1.2 项目环境搭建 课上用到的软件 JDK8 MySQL ...
spring-cloud-starter-alibaba-nacos-discovery 遵循了 Spring Cloud Common 标准,实现了 AutoServiceRegistration、ServiceRegistry、Registration 这三个接口。 在Spring Cloud 应用的启动阶段,监听了 WebServerInitializedEvent 事件,当 Web 容器初始化完成后,即收到 WebServerInitializedEvent 事件后,会触发注册的动作,调用...
SpringCloud详细教程 | 第一篇: 服务的注册与发现Eureka(Greenwich版本) spring boot 微服务是指开发一个单个小型的但有业务功能的服务,每个服务都有自己的处理和轻量通讯机制,简单的说就是对系统进行拆分,拆分多个服务,每个服务运行在其独立的进程中,服务和服务之间采用轻量级的通信机制相互沟通(通常是基于HTTP的Restfu...
1. 新建Maven父工程springcloud-alibaba-parent 2. 新建子模块nacos-provider-8000 - 提供Ctroller、Service、Mapper(略,暂定使用集合数据充当DB) - 提供对外接口,http://ip+端口/URI/entityInfo 3. 新建子模块nacos-consumer_9000 - 提供Ctroller,实现远程调用nacos-provider-8000工程对外提供数据接口 ...
这样的需求,都是建立在SpringCloudAlibaba框架下完成的,使用便把学习RocketMQ的内容记录下来,方便复习和以后粘贴的使用。 学习内容 一、MQ简介 1、什么是MQ MQ(Message Queue)是一种跨进程的通信机制,用于传递消息。通俗点说,就是一个先进先出的数据结构。 2、MQ的应用场景 (1)、异步解耦 最常见的一个场景是用...
视频:4-3 为项目整合Spring Cloud Alibaba (03:30) 作业:4-4 Spring Cloud Alibaba使用场景 第5章 服务发现-Nacos8 节 | 41分钟 这一章带我们先剖析服务发现原理,然后将应用注册到Nacos上,分析核心的Nacos服务发现,进而实现对Nacos的监控,最后学习搭建Nacos集群. ...
整合Spring-Cloud-Alibaba整合Spring Cloud 参考官方文档在pom.xml加入 <properties> <spring.cloud-version>Hoxton.SR8</spring.cloud-version> </properties> <dependencyManagement> <dependencies> <!--整合spring-cloud--> <dependency> <groupId>org.springframework.cloud</groupId> <artifactId>spring-cloud-...
SpringCloud:部分组件停止维护和更新,给开发带来不便;SpringCloud 部分环境搭建复杂, 没有完善的可视化界面,我们需要大量的二次开发和定制;SpringCloud 配置复杂,难以上手, 部分配置差别难以区分和合理应用 Srpingcloud Alibaba:阿里使用过的组件经历了考验,性能强悍,设计合理,现在开源 出来成套的产品搭配完善的可视化界面给...